A Turning Point: The Van Rossem Hard Fork
The launch of the Van Rossem hard fork on July 18 marked a pivotal moment for Cardano. It activated Protocol Version 11, significantly enhancing the smart contract functionalities inherent to the network. These enhancements aim to attract decentralized application developers, ultimately aiming at building a more robust ecosystem around ADA. Charles Hoskinson, Cardano’s founder, emphasized the importance of this upgrade, insisting that it sets the foundation for upcoming improvements like Ouroboros Leios, which further aims to enhance Cardano’s scalability.
This hard fork has not only optimized the blockchain's operational efficiency but also shifted the governance structures towards a model that fosters greater community engagement. By incorporating community participation in governance, Cardano aims to create a decentralized model that promotes sustainability and inclusivity, crucial for long-term growth.
The Whale Factor: Accumulation Drives Price
Recent reports have shed light on the substantial whale activity surrounding ADA, with large holders amassing over 240 million ADA within just a few days. This accumulation has played a critical role in pushing the price of ADA upward by approximately 22%, indicating a robust confidence from major investors in the cryptocurrency. As ADA's price briefly peaked at $0.190, such movements illustrate how whale participation can significantly influence market dynamics and investor sentiments.
The increase in whale activity aligns closely with the technological advancements following the Van Rossem hard fork. Analysts suggest that large buy-ins by whales often signal bullish trends, especially when they coincide with major network upgrades. Specifically, the recent accumulation trends are indicative of a broader resurgence of interest in Cardano, which was previously clouded by fluctuations and market uncertainties in recent months.
Technical Insights: Bridging to Future Price Targets
As Cardano's price oscillates around critical support and resistance levels, technical analysts are monitoring the potential for further upward movement. Following the bullish reversal patterns, ADA is showing signs of breaking through key resistance levels that could lead to price targets close to $0.208. This point presents a critical barrier, as a sustained close above this level could confirm a more durable bullish trend for ADA.
Moreover, as Cardano moves closer to achieving six months of CME futures trading, markets are increasingly watching for implications this might have for broader regulated investment products, including potential ETFs. These developments could further solidify investor confidence and may serve as a catalyst for future price elevations, potentially pushing Cardano back into the top tiers of the cryptocurrency market.
